Frequently Asked Questions about Ford E-Transit Cargo Van in Petaluma, CA

What is the range capability of the new Ford E-Transit Cargo Van?

The E-Transit features an 89kWh high-voltage battery designed to handle local delivery routes and daily business operations. Its electric-focused powertrain provides the consistent range needed for navigating Petaluma, CA and surrounding areas without the need for traditional fuel stops.

How does the E-Transit handle local road conditions?

Equipped with Ford Co-Pilot360 and side wind stabilization, this van offers enhanced control during highway driving on US-101. The rear-wheel-drive platform and electric power-assist steering ensure a responsive, stable ride when navigating busy shopping corridors or local intersections.

What cargo features are standard on the E-Transit?

The van includes split swing-out rear cargo access for easy loading in tight spaces. It also features a flat floor design and a tire mobility kit, ensuring your workspace remains functional and organized for daily business tasks.

What interior comfort features are included?

The cabin comes with Dark Palazzo Gray cloth heated bucket seats, including 2-way manual driver seat adjustment with lumbar support. These features are designed to provide comfort during long workdays in varying seasonal temperatures.

Interior Configurations and Driver Comfort

The cabin of the E-Transit is built for utility, featuring Dark Palazzo Gray cloth heated bucket seats that provide comfort during long shifts. These seats include 2-way manual driver seat adjustment with lumbar support, which is essential for maintaining posture during a busy day of driving in Cotati, CA or Penngrove, CA.

When deciding on your van, consider how the cabin technology supports your workday. While you might compare this van to the Maverick for smaller, lighter tasks, the E-Transit provides significantly more enclosed cargo space for secure storage of your tools and supplies.

  • Dark Palazzo Gray cloth seating provides a professional look that remains comfortable throughout changing seasonal temperatures.
  • Manual 2-way adjustable headrests and integrated armrests help reduce fatigue during longer shifts behind the wheel.
  • Front-only vinyl/rubber flooring makes it easy to maintain a clean cabin after loading gear in rainy or muddy conditions.

Cargo Utility and Loading Efficiency

The cargo area of the Ford E-Transit is engineered for practical, heavy-duty use. With its split swing-out rear cargo access, you can easily load and unload items, which is particularly helpful when you are working in tight spaces or busy parking areas near the city center.

When you visit Hansel Ford of Petaluma, bring along your most common cargo items to see how they fit within the van's footprint. This hands-on approach helps you understand the true utility of the space compared to smaller SUVs like the Bronco Sport or the Escape.

  • Split swing-out rear doors allow for convenient access to your cargo even when parking in constrained areas.
  • Tire mobility kit is included to help you get back on the road quickly in the event of a minor flat.
  • High-voltage battery placement is optimized to maintain a flat floor for maximum cargo utility and easier item stacking.
